**Ticket SR-1188 — Relevance regression after synonym expansion**

After enabling the Quillfisher synonym pack, queries for "lantern" began ranking accessory listings above the lantern category itself. Suspect the boost weights in the tuning notes from the Hollowmere sprint were applied to the wrong field. Tuning notes attached; do not revert blindly, as CTR improved for two other verticals. Reproduce against the index snapshot identified by the token below.

build token for yajof-bajof: htk31_506ff1188f74596b5bb2eec94edc43c

Subject: Quickstore 4.2 — bloom filter now fronts the KV layer

Plugin authors: starting with this release, Quickstore places a bloom filter ahead of the key-value store. Negative lookups return faster; false positives fall through safely. No API changes are required on your side. Verify your plugin against the staging build referenced below.

session token of fahif-tadup = htk3_9c7

## Deployment

The revamped password reset flow for Larkspur Accounts ships as its own service, `larkspur-reset`, deployed separately from the monolith. New team members should note that reset tokens are now single-use and minted by this service, not the legacy auth module. Deploys go through the standard pipeline: build, staging soak for one hour, then prod rollout in three waves. Rollback is a single pipeline action and is safe at any point. Before your first deploy, verify the service picks up the settings shown below.

service settings:
[silwyn]
host = silwyn.crelvogrid.internal
user = silwyn_svc
database = silwyn_prod

Runbook: Account Recovery during Reconnect-Bug Review (Tarnwell Systems). Reviewers of the Lattermist websocket patch occasionally lock their staging accounts when the reconnect loop replays stale auth tokens. Do not reset the account through the admin console; that invalidates the review session and the reproduction traces. Instead, run the recovery CLI from the bastion, select the staging realm, and choose token replay as the lockout cause. When the CLI asks for the reviewer recovery passphrase, enter the value directly below this paragraph.

vault phrase of bagaf-kajeg = jorath-feniel-briir-siliel-ralix